Former US First Lady Nancy Reagan Laid To Rest

The funeral service for former First Lady of the United States Nancy
Reagan is underway at the Reagan Memorial Library in Simi Valley
California. Political and Hollywood heavyweights have gathered for the
private event. Mrs. Reagan is best remembered for lending her voice to
anti-drug campaigns and Alzheimer's awareness, and for offering
unwavering support to her husband, the late President Ronald Reagan,
during his time in office.

Families of 9/11 victims seek to restore Saudi Arabia as a defendant

An appeal has been filed in New York to have Saudi Arabia restored as
a defendant in a lawsuit connected with the attacks on 9/11.

15 of the 19 plane hijackers were from Saudi Arabia and attorneys are
calling on an appeals court to dismiss the argument that the nation is
protected by sovereign immunity.

UN Publishes Harrowing Report on South Sudan Violence

'One of the most horrendous human rights situations in the world' - that's how the UN High Commissioner for Human Rights has described what's going on in South Sudan.

He was speaking after the UN published a new, 102 page report on South Sudan, saying that all parties have committed serious and systematic violence against civilians there.

Carson endorses Trump

Former Republican presidential candidate Ben Carson has endorsed Donald Trump for president.

The retired neurosurgeon joins the ranks of businesswoman Carly Fiorina and New Jersey governor Chris Christie in endorsing the controversial Trump, after they themselves dropped out of the race.

Mr. Carson said he's seen "two Donald Trumps" - one who is bombastic on the stage, and the other who is more cerebral.

Russia pledges tighter doping control, harsher punishments for faking tests

Russian sports officials admit to responsibility for doping scandal involving Russian athletes using meldonium, a drug banned by the World Anti-Doping Agency in January this year. Moscow pledged tighter control over substance use by Russian athletes and greater responsibility for faking doping results. Daria Bondarchuk reports from the Russian capital.

Republicans Presidential candidates set a calmer tone

The Republican US Presidential candidates have set the name-calling
aside and focused on policies in the latest televised debate.

It was a friendlier affair that saw the final four spar over
immigration, education, Islam and the Middle East peace process.

The debate in Miami is the last big test before the winner-takes-all
primaries of Florida and Ohio on Tuesday.

Frontrunner Donald Trump said considering his huge support the
Republican party should unite behind him.

Nancy Reagan Funeral To Be Held Friday

American flags are flying at half staff this week to honor the life of Nancy Reagan, who served as First Lady of the United States from 1981 to 1989. She will be laid to rest Friday next to her late husband, former US President Ronald Reagan at The Reagan Memorial Library in Simi Valley, California.

UN release report on alleged sexual exploitation

The UN report on alleged sexual exploitation and abuse within its peacekeeping
missions was brought to the Security Council in New York this Thursday.
Secretary General Ban Ki Moon highlighted new measures to address an
uptick in abuse allegations - there were 69 such accusations in 2015.

European Central Bank president Mario Draghi slashes interest rates to 0%

The President of the European Central Bank Mario Draghi has cut interest rates to zero per cent.

It was an unexpected move but the ECB is pushing to boost inflation rates in the single currency eurozone which have been at or below zero for the past year.

The ECB is also going to make it more expensive for banks to park their money at the ECB so they are encouraged to invest in businesses.

He'll do this by setting the ECB's deposit rate at minus nought point four percent which is one percentage point lower than previously.

Monthly purchases of government bonds - known as quantitative easing  - by the ECB are increasing from about 66 to 88 billion dollars.

ECB president Mario Draghi says they expect these measures should be enough to get inflation increasing again.
